This challenge is weird, and takes patience.

It's also quite simple.  Build a ship to visit every planet, and a lander to land on them.  The trick is, you can only use the Dawn Engine to get to every planet.  However, you can use liquid fuel to build the ship.  And liquid fuel for the ONE lander.  But that's it!

So, you need:

1 ship, with as many Dawn Engines as you wish/need, 1 lander, and whatever else you want.

1 lander, with whatever you need.

1 Kerbol System.

At least 1 Kerbal.

Rulez:

Ship must be powered only by the dawn engine.

The lander is the only thing powered by liquid fuel.

Ship and lander must be separate, and be attached by docking.

No mods, however, MechJeb IS allowed.

Good Luck!

I would have to agree that the challenge looks both easy and require a lot of patience. Since you're allowed to use liquid fuel to actually build the ship (required to actually get into orbit from Kerbin since the dawn engine has too low of a thrust to even get itself into orbit). Once in orbit, the acceleration of your vessel can approach zero and you'll still be able to escape the planet or moon. So you have two crafts. The lander which is capable of landing and taking off from any system body and the fuel tanker that actually moves from system to system. So figure out how much fuel you actually need to perform the various landings and then push that tank of fuel using a Dawn engine along with enough xenon to go to each planet and moon. You may be able to reduce the overall size of the craft by including a ISRU to make more fuel for the lander.
